「Windows 10 に Perl をインストールする方法|ステップバイステップ解説」

Windows 10にPerlをインストールする方法について、ステップバイステップで解説します。Perlは、テキスト処理やウェブ開発など、さまざまな用途で利用されるスクリプト言語です。しかし、Windows環境でのインストールは初心者にとってやや複雑に感じられることがあります。この記事では、ActiveState Perlを使用して、Windows 10にPerlを簡単にインストールする手順を詳しく説明します。
まず、ActiveState Perlの公式サイトからインストーラーをダウンロードし、インストールウィザードに従って進めます。インストールが完了したら、コマンドプロンプトを使ってPerlが正しく動作するか確認します。また、インストール先の変更や、インストールされているPerlのバージョンを確認する方法についても触れます。
さらに、インストール中に発生する可能性のある問題や、既に別のバージョンのPerlがインストールされている場合の対処法についても解説します。この記事を読むことで、Windows 10でPerlをスムーズに利用するための知識が得られるでしょう。
イントロダクション
Windows 10にPerlをインストールする方法について、ステップバイステップで解説します。Perlは、テキスト処理やウェブ開発など、さまざまな用途で利用されるスクリプト言語です。しかし、Windows環境でのインストールは、初心者にとって少し難しいと感じられるかもしれません。この記事では、ActiveState Perlを使用して、Windows 10にPerlを簡単にインストールする方法を詳しく説明します。
まず、Perlをインストールするためには、ActiveState Perlの公式サイトからインストーラーをダウンロードする必要があります。ダウンロードが完了したら、インストーラーを実行し、画面の指示に従って進めていきます。インストール中に、インストール先のディレクトリを指定するオプションが表示されますが、特に変更する必要がなければ、デフォルトの設定のまま進めて問題ありません。
インストールが完了したら、Perlが正しく動作するかどうかを確認するために、コマンドプロンプトを開いてバージョン確認を行います。これにより、Perlが正常にインストールされたかどうかを確認できます。また、インストール中に問題が発生した場合や、既に別のバージョンのPerlがインストールされている場合の対処法についても触れていきます。この記事を参考に、Windows 10でPerlを活用するための第一歩を踏み出してください。
Perlとは
Perlは、テキスト処理やウェブ開発、システム管理など、多岐にわたる用途で利用されるスクリプト言語です。1987年にLarry Wallによって開発され、その柔軟性と強力な正規表現機能により、特にテキスト処理において高い評価を得ています。Perlは「実用性」を重視して設計されており、プログラマが効率的に作業を進めることができるよう、多くの便利な機能が提供されています。
Perlはクロスプラットフォーム対応しており、Windows、macOS、Linuxなど、さまざまなオペレーティングシステムで動作します。特に、Windows 10環境での利用も可能ですが、インストール手順が他のOSと異なるため、初めてのユーザーにとってはやや複雑に感じられるかもしれません。しかし、適切な手順を踏むことで、誰でも簡単にPerlを利用できるようになります。
Perlのもう一つの特徴は、CPAN(Comprehensive Perl Archive Network)と呼ばれる豊富なモジュールライブラリです。CPANを利用することで、Perlの機能を拡張し、さまざまなタスクを効率的に実行することが可能です。このような理由から、Perlは今日でも多くの開発者に愛用されている言語の一つです。
必要な準備
Windows 10にPerlをインストールする前に、いくつかの準備が必要です。まず、インターネットに接続されていることを確認してください。インストールファイルのダウンロードや、必要な依存関係の取得にインターネット接続が不可欠です。また、管理者権限を持ったユーザーアカウントでログインしていることも重要です。管理者権限がないと、システム全体に影響を与えるソフトウェアのインストールが制限される場合があります。
次に、ディスクスペースを確認しましょう。Perlのインストールには、それほど多くのスペースを必要としませんが、余裕を持って数GB程度の空き容量があることを確認しておくと安心です。さらに、Windows 10が最新の状態であるかどうかも確認してください。OSの更新が行われていない場合、インストール中に予期せぬ問題が発生する可能性があります。
最後に、インストール先のディレクトリを決めておくことも重要です。デフォルトのインストールパスを使用することもできますが、特定のディレクトリにインストールしたい場合は、そのパスをメモしておくとスムーズに進められます。これらの準備を整えることで、Perlのインストールがより円滑に進むでしょう。
ActiveState Perlのダウンロード
ActiveState Perlは、Windows環境でPerlを簡単にインストールするための優れた選択肢です。まず、ActiveStateの公式ウェブサイトにアクセスし、最新バージョンのPerlをダウンロードします。サイトでは、Windows用のインストーラーが提供されており、これをダウンロードすることで、インストールプロセスがスムーズに進みます。ダウンロードが完了したら、インストーラーを実行し、指示に従って進めます。この際、インストール先のディレクトリを指定するオプションが表示されるため、必要に応じて変更することが可能です。
インストール中には、環境変数の設定に関するオプションが表示される場合があります。この設定を有効にすることで、コマンドプロンプトから直接Perlを実行できるようになります。特に、開発環境を整える際には、この設定が重要です。インストールが完了したら、コマンドプロンプトを開き、perl -vと入力して、インストールされたPerlのバージョンを確認します。これにより、Perlが正しくインストールされたかどうかを確認できます。
もし、インストール中に問題が発生した場合や、既に別のバージョンのPerlがインストールされている場合には、既存の環境変数を確認し、必要に応じて調整することが推奨されます。これにより、複数のバージョンのPerlが競合することなく、スムーズに動作する環境を構築できます。
インストール手順
Windows 10にPerlをインストールする手順は、初心者でも簡単に進められるよう設計されています。まず、ActiveState Perlの公式サイトにアクセスし、最新バージョンのインストーラーをダウンロードします。ダウンロードが完了したら、インストーラーを実行し、表示されるインストールウィザードに従って進めます。ウィザードでは、インストール先のディレクトリや追加オプションを選択できますが、特に変更が必要なければデフォルト設定のまま進めることをおすすめします。
インストールが完了したら、コマンドプロンプトを開いてperl -vと入力し、Perlのバージョンが表示されるか確認します。これにより、インストールが正しく行われたかどうかを確認できます。もしバージョン情報が表示されない場合は、環境変数PATHにPerlのインストール先が追加されていない可能性があります。その場合は、手動でPATHを設定する必要があります。
また、既に別のバージョンのPerlがインストールされている場合、新しいバージョンをインストールする前に、古いバージョンをアンインストールするか、バージョン管理ツールを使用して切り替えることが推奨されます。これにより、システムの競合を防ぎ、スムーズに作業を進めることができます。インストール中に問題が発生した場合は、公式ドキュメントやコミュニティフォーラムを参照して解決策を探すことが有効です。
インストール先の変更
Windows 10にPerlをインストールする際、デフォルトのインストール先は通常「C:Perl」となっていますが、ユーザーの環境や好みに応じてインストール先を変更することが可能です。インストール先を変更する理由としては、システムドライブの容量を節約したい、特定のプロジェクト用に専用のディレクトリを用意したいなどが挙げられます。
インストール先を変更するには、ActiveState Perlのインストールウィザードを進める際に、インストール先のパスを指定する画面が表示されます。この画面で、デフォルトのパスを編集し、任意のディレクトリを指定することができます。例えば、「D:ProgramsPerl」のように、他のドライブやフォルダを指定することで、システムドライブの負荷を軽減することが可能です。
ただし、インストール先を変更する際には、指定したディレクトリが正しくアクセス可能であることを確認する必要があります。また、インストール後に環境変数の設定が正しく行われているかも確認しましょう。特に、PATHに新しいインストール先が追加されているかどうかは、Perlのコマンドが正しく動作するために重要です。インストール先を変更した場合でも、これらの設定が適切に行われていれば、問題なくPerlを使用することができます。
インストール後の動作確認
インストール後の動作確認は、Perlが正しくインストールされたことを確認するための重要なステップです。まず、コマンドプロンプトを開き、perl -vと入力してEnterキーを押します。これにより、インストールされたPerlのバージョン情報が表示されます。バージョン情報が表示されれば、Perlが正常にインストールされていることが確認できます。
次に、簡単なスクリプトを実行して、Perlが実際に動作するかどうかを確認します。テキストエディタで新しいファイルを作成し、print "Hello, World!n";と記述して、hello.plという名前で保存します。その後、コマンドプロンプトでperl hello.plと入力して実行します。画面に「Hello, World!」と表示されれば、Perlが正しく動作していることが確認できます。
これらの手順を通じて、Perlのインストールが成功し、動作環境が整っていることを確認できます。もしもエラーメッセージが表示された場合や、スクリプトが実行されない場合は、インストール手順を再度確認し、必要に応じて再インストールを行うことをお勧めします。
バージョン確認の方法
Perlをインストールした後、正しく動作しているかどうかを確認するために、バージョン確認を行うことが重要です。Windows 10では、コマンドプロンプトを使用して簡単にPerlのバージョンを確認できます。まず、コマンドプロンプトを開き、perl -vと入力してEnterキーを押します。これにより、インストールされているPerlのバージョン情報が表示されます。表示される情報には、Perlのバージョン番号やビルド日、ライセンス情報などが含まれています。
もしバージョン情報が表示されない場合、環境変数の設定に問題がある可能性があります。この場合、PerlのインストールディレクトリがシステムのPATHに正しく追加されているかどうかを確認する必要があります。PATHが正しく設定されていないと、コマンドプロンプトからPerlを実行することができません。PATHの設定方法は、コントロールパネルからシステムの詳細設定を開き、環境変数を編集することで行えます。
また、複数のPerlバージョンをインストールしている場合、どのバージョンがデフォルトで使用されているかを確認することも重要です。これにより、特定のプロジェクトで必要なバージョンを確実に使用することができます。バージョン確認は、Perlのインストールが成功したかどうかを確認するための最初のステップであり、今後の開発作業においても重要な役割を果たします。
インストール中の問題と対処法
Perlのインストール中に問題が発生した場合、いくつかの対処法を試すことができます。まず、インストールウィザードが正しく動作しない場合、システムの管理者権限で実行しているか確認してください。管理者権限がないと、必要なファイルの書き込みが制限されることがあります。また、インターネット接続が不安定な場合、ダウンロードが途中で失敗することがあるため、安定したネットワーク環境で再度試してみてください。
次に、既存のPerlバージョンがインストールされている場合、新しいバージョンのインストールが競合を引き起こすことがあります。このような場合は、既存のPerlをアンインストールしてから再度インストールを試みるか、異なるディレクトリにインストールすることを検討してください。さらに、環境変数の設定が正しく行われていないと、Perlが正常に動作しないことがあります。インストール後に環境変数が自動的に設定されない場合は、手動で設定を行う必要があります。
最後に、インストールが完了してもPerlが動作しない場合、パスの設定やバージョンの確認を行ってください。コマンドプロンプトでperl -vと入力し、正しいバージョンが表示されるか確認します。表示されない場合は、パスが正しく設定されていない可能性があるため、環境変数の設定を再度確認してください。これらの対処法を試しても問題が解決しない場合、公式のサポートフォーラムやコミュニティで情報を探すことも有効です。
既存のPerlバージョンがある場合の対応
既存のPerlバージョンがインストールされている場合、新しいバージョンをインストールする前にいくつかの注意点があります。まず、現在のバージョンを確認することが重要です。コマンドプロンプトでperl -vと入力すると、インストールされているPerlのバージョン情報が表示されます。これにより、新しいバージョンをインストールする必要があるかどうかを判断できます。
既存のバージョンが古い場合や、特定のプロジェクトで異なるバージョンが必要な場合は、新しいバージョンをインストールすることが推奨されます。ただし、既存のバージョンをそのまま残しておきたい場合、環境変数を適切に設定することで、複数のバージョンを共存させることが可能です。環境変数のPATHを編集し、新しいバージョンのインストールパスを追加することで、システムが新しいバージョンを優先して使用するようになります。
また、既存のバージョンをアンインストールする必要がある場合、コントロールパネルからプログラムを削除するか、インストール時に使用したインストーラーを再度実行してアンインストールオプションを選択します。この際、重要なスクリプトや設定ファイルが削除されないよう、バックアップを取ることを忘れないでください。
まとめ
Perlは、テキスト処理やウェブ開発など、さまざまな用途で利用されるスクリプト言語です。Windows 10にPerlをインストールするためには、まずActiveState Perlの公式サイトからインストーラーをダウンロードします。ダウンロードが完了したら、インストーラーを実行し、インストールウィザードに従って進めます。このプロセスでは、インストール先のディレクトリを指定したり、環境変数を自動的に設定するオプションを選択したりすることができます。
インストールが完了したら、コマンドプロンプトを開いてperl -vと入力し、インストールされたPerlのバージョンを確認します。これにより、Perlが正しくインストールされたかどうかを確認できます。もしバージョン情報が表示されない場合、環境変数の設定に問題がある可能性があるため、手動で設定を確認する必要があります。
また、既に別のバージョンのPerlがインストールされている場合、新しいバージョンをインストールする前に、既存のバージョンをアンインストールするか、パスの設定を調整することが推奨されます。これにより、システム上のPerlのバージョン管理が容易になります。インストール中に問題が発生した場合、公式のドキュメントやフォーラムを参照して解決策を探すことができます。
以上が、Windows 10にPerlをインストールするための基本的な手順です。このガイドに従うことで、Perlのインストールをスムーズに行い、開発環境を整えることができます。
よくある質問
Windows 10にPerlをインストールする際に必要な前提条件は何ですか?
Windows 10にPerlをインストールするためには、いくつかの前提条件があります。まず、管理者権限を持ったユーザーアカウントが必要です。これにより、システム全体に影響を与えるソフトウェアのインストールが可能になります。また、インターネット接続も必要です。Perlのインストーラーや必要なパッケージをダウンロードするために使用されます。さらに、システムが最新の状態であることを確認するために、Windows Updateを実行しておくことをお勧めします。これにより、互換性の問題を防ぐことができます。
Perlのインストール中にエラーが発生した場合、どうすればよいですか?
Perlのインストール中にエラーが発生した場合、まずはエラーメッセージを確認することが重要です。エラーメッセージには、問題の原因が具体的に記載されていることが多いです。例えば、ファイルのダウンロードに失敗した場合、インターネット接続を確認し、ファイアウォールやセキュリティソフトがインストールを妨げていないかチェックします。また、管理者権限でインストーラーを実行しているかどうかも確認してください。それでも解決しない場合は、Perlの公式フォーラムやコミュニティで同様の問題を検索し、解決策を探すことが有効です。
Perlのインストール後に環境変数を設定する必要はありますか?
Perlのインストール後に環境変数を設定することは、非常に重要です。環境変数を設定することで、コマンドプロンプトやPowerShellから直接Perlを実行できるようになります。通常、インストーラーが自動的に環境変数を設定してくれる場合もありますが、手動で設定する必要がある場合もあります。具体的には、PATH環境変数にPerlの実行ファイルが格納されているディレクトリを追加します。これにより、どのディレクトリからでもPerlコマンドを実行できるようになります。環境変数の設定方法は、システムのプロパティから行うことができます。
Perlのインストールが成功したかどうかを確認する方法は?
Perlのインストールが成功したかどうかを確認するには、コマンドプロンプトまたはPowerShellを開き、perl -vと入力します。これにより、インストールされたPerlのバージョン情報が表示されます。バージョン情報が表示されれば、インストールは成功しています。また、簡単なPerlスクリプトを実行して、正しく動作するかどうかを確認することもできます。例えば、print "Hello, World!n";というスクリプトを実行し、期待通りの出力が得られるかどうかをチェックします。これにより、Perlが正しくインストールされ、動作していることを確認できます。
コメントを残す
コメントを投稿するにはログインしてください。

関連ブログ記事